Looks like we’ve got a tight battle for best kicks of the last two nights! Monta Ellis went on repeat mode, but kept it fiery with the Air Jordan XI ‘Bred’, but up-and-comer Delonte West caught our attention by wearing the Nike Air Flight One in the ‘Orlando’ colorway. Kendrick Perkins’ Air Jordan X ‘Chicago’ deserves some attention, as does Gilbert Arenas’ back-to-back Air Jordan showing of the Old Royal X and the Air Jordan IX ‘For The Love Of The Game’. A blue-based jersey seems to follow Gilbert wherever he lands, but that’s only good news because we know what he’s capable of putting out when rocking those colors!
